AGGIORNA CACHE

Si applica a:segno di spunta sì Databricks Runtime

Invalida e aggiorna tutti i dati memorizzati nella cache (e i metadati associati) nella cache apache Spark per tutti i set di dati che contengono il percorso dell'origine dati specificato. La corrispondenza del percorso è basata sul prefisso, vale a dire, / invalida tutto ciò che viene memorizzato nella cache.

Vedere REFRESH (MATERIALIZED VIEW and STREAMING TABLE) per aggiornare i dati nelle tabelle di streaming e nelle viste materializzate.

Sintassi

REFRESH resource_path

Per informazioni sulle differenze tra la memorizzazione nella cache del disco e la cache di Apache Spark, vedere Cache del disco e Cache Spark.

Parametri

  • resource_path

    Percorso della risorsa da aggiornare.

Esempi

-- The Path is resolved using the datasource's File Index.
> CREATE TABLE test(ID INT) using parquet;
> INSERT INTO test SELECT 1000;
> CACHE TABLE test;
> INSERT INTO test SELECT 100;
> REFRESH "hdfs://path/to/table";